CHENNAI, April 18. /Dunyo IA/. Embassy of Uzbekistan in Delhi, together with the regional branch of the Confederation of Indian Industry (Confederation of Indian Industries - CII) in Tamil Nadu, organized a roundtable in Chennai - one of the key industrial and technological hubs of South India, reports Dunyo IA correspondent.
The event brought together representatives of the Indian business community interested in expanding cooperation with Uzbekistan.
Ambassador Sardor Rustambaev provided participants with a detailed overview of Uzbekistan’s economic development dynamics and key reforms aimed at creating the most favourable business climate possible. Diplomat specifically emphasized the conditions for implementing investment projects and the guarantees for protecting the rights of foreign investors.
As part of the presentation, the advantages of Uzbekistan's special economic zones and industrial parks were presented in detail. Indian businessmen received comprehensive information on tax incentives and preferences, as well as state support measures available to foreign companies.
Indian side showed keen interest in establishing cooperation across a wide range of areas. Among the priorities mentioned were the automotive and machinery industries, pharmaceuticals, the textile industry, digital technologies, artificial intelligence, alternative energy and education.
Special emphasis was placed on specific industrial projects. Indian companies expressed interest in organizing production in Uzbekistan for automotive components, drones, sensors and other high-demand products.
The meeting was held in an interactive format. Indian entrepreneurs received detailed answers to all their questions, including practical aspects of doing business in Uzbekistan.
At the conclusion of the “roundtable”, all participating companies were invited to take part in the 5th Tashkent International Investment Forum, which will be held in June this year.
